About Episodes


Episodes is a journal published by International Union of Geological Sciences. This journal covers the area[s] related to Earth and Planetary Sciences (miscellaneous), etc. The coverage history of this journal is as follows: 1979-1989, 1992, 1996-2022. The rank of this journal is 6092. This journal's impact score, h-index, and SJR are 3.08, 79, and 0.789, respectively. The ISSN of this journal is/are as follows: 07053797.

The best quartile of Episodes is Q1. This journal has received a total of 414 citations during the last three years (Preceding 2022).

Episodes h-index


  Table Setting

The h-index of Episodes is 79. By definition of the h-index, this journal has at least 79 published articles with more than 79 citations.

What is h-index?

The h-index (also known as the Hirsch index or Hirsh index) is a scientometric parameter used to evaluate the scientific impact of the publications and journals. It is defined as the maximum value of h such that the given Journal has published at least h papers and each has at least h citations.




Episodes ISSN


The International Standard Serial Number (ISSN) of Episodes is/are as follows: 07053797.

The ISSN is a unique 8-digit identifier for a specific publication like Magazine or Journal. The ISSN is used in the postal system and in the publishing world to identify the articles that are published in journals, magazines, newsletters, etc. This is the number assigned to your article by the publisher, and it is the one you will use to reference your article within the library catalogues.

ISSN code (also called as "ISSN structure" or "ISSN syntax") can be expressed as follows: NNNN-NNNC
Here, N is in the set {0,1,2,3...,9}, a digit character, and C is in {0,1,2,3,...,9,X}

Abbreviation


The International Organization for Standardization 4 (ISO 4) abbreviation of Episodes is Episodes. ISO 4 is an international standard which defines a uniform and consistent system for the abbreviation of serial publication titles, which are published regularly. The primary use of ISO 4 is to abbreviate or shorten the names of scientific journals using the technique of List of Title Word Abbreviations (LTWA).

As ISO 4 is an international standard, the abbreviation ('Episodes') can be used for citing, indexing, abstraction, and referencing purposes.
